Colorful Coloring Pages
One of the most popular types of zoo printables for preschoolers is coloring pages. These pages feature cute and cuddly animals in various poses, ready to be brought to life with your child’s favorite colors. Coloring not only helps children develop fine motor skills and hand-eye coordination but also allows them to express their creativity and imagination. With zoo coloring pages, your child can practice identifying colors, following directions, and staying within the lines while having a blast.
In addition to traditional coloring pages, you can also find more challenging options such as color by number or color by shape worksheets. These activities require children to match numbers or shapes to specific colors, adding an extra layer of learning to the coloring process. By completing these pages, your child will not only practice their coloring skills but also reinforce their knowledge of numbers and shapes in a fun and engaging way.
Puzzling Puzzles and Matching Games
For preschoolers who love a good challenge, zoo printables offer a variety of puzzles and matching games to keep them entertained. From jigsaw puzzles featuring their favorite animals to memory games that test their ability to match pairs, these activities are sure to keep your child engaged and excited. Puzzles and matching games help children develop critical thinking skills, improve their memory, and enhance their problem-solving abilities – all while having fun with adorable zoo animals.
In addition to traditional puzzles and matching games, you can also find more creative options such as animal shadow matching or animal habitat sorting activities. These games encourage children to think critically about the characteristics of different animals and their natural habitats, helping them develop a deeper understanding of the world around them. By completing these puzzles and games, your child will not only have a blast but also learn valuable lessons about wildlife and conservation.
